DeepSeek Harness, the builder
The first thing that hits you is the UI. You open the browser, it's a local web page. No desktop app to launch, no extra tab. You already live in the browser, Harness moves in.
The model is a plugin. The tools are plugins. Memory, session locks, search, sub-agents, scheduling. Everything. Even the main loop that makes the agent think is a plugin. You can pull any piece out and replace it without touching the core.
And then there's creator mode. That's where it gets interesting.
You open a session, pick creator mode, and describe what you want. I asked for a daily task scheduler with time slots, days, and repeat options. Result: it designed the day logic, planned the UI, validated the options, and wrote the CSS live. In minutes.
In Hermes, the same class of workflow exists (Hermes Astra, Hermes Muse, Hermes Oracle). Each one took me hours of coding.
Harness is clay. Hermes is concrete once it's set.
What Harness does better
- Coding and building: faster, more reliable, doesn't timeout on big tasks
- Tool creation: creator mode rebuilds the UI in minutes
- Built-in model: DeepSeek V4 Pro is designed for Harness ($0.44 per million input tokens, $0.87 output)
- Simplicity: plain text, easy config, feels like Claude Code
- Flexibility: DeepSeek V4 Flash is free, you can plug in any model
What it doesn't do yet
- No persistent memory between sessions
- No self-improvement loop
- No native messaging channels
- Version 0.1, it will break sometimes
Hermes, the memory
Hermes is the other beast. And where Harness builds fast, Hermes learns.
Three layers of memory. A self-improvement loop. When Hermes solves a problem, it saves what it learned as a skill. Next time the same job comes around, it's faster because it remembers.
Almost no other agent does this.
And then there are the channels. Telegram, WhatsApp, Discord, Microsoft Teams, iMessage. Natively. No plugin to configure, no webhook to set up. You want an alert on your phone? Hermes sends it where you already are.
What Hermes does better
- Memory: three layers + self-improvement = each run is faster
- Messaging: five native channels, zero configuration
- Recurring tasks: research, monitoring, reports, everything that repeats
- Scheduling: cron-style, like other agents
What it doesn't do well
- Big builds: timeout on large coding tasks
- UI: more complex, more noise, longer to get used to
- Model: its own models aren't frontier level
- Desktop only: it's a separate app, another tab to click into
The routing table
Here's the rule I now apply:
| Task type | Tool | Why |
|---|---|---|
| Recurring research (monitoring, reports) | Hermes | Memory makes each run faster |
| Big build or refactor | DeepSeek Harness | Doesn't timeout, much faster |
| Team alerts and approvals | Hermes | Native messaging on five channels |
| Internal tooling (dashboards, scripts) | Harness | Creator mode builds the UI in minutes |
| Cost-sensitive work | Harness | Model is a plugin, DeepSeek V4 Flash is free |
| Long scheduled jobs | Both | Both support cron-style scheduling |
Both tools are free. Open source. And the brain can be free too: plug DeepSeek V4 Flash (free) into both and the bill drops to zero.
The math changes completely. The constraint stops being budget and becomes design.
The solo agent trap
Here's what happened to me. I started with one agent. For everything. Coding, memory, scheduling, alerts. Result: it did two or three things well, and the rest slipped through.
When it times out on a long job, everything downstream never happens. Silently. No error, no alert. Just... nothing.
One agent between a job and a business result is a single point of failure. If it breaks, everything breaks.
The solution: an orchestrator in front. Both agents behind it, each in its lane. The orchestrator routes, logs everything, and keeps the fallback wired in.
Concretely, it looks like this:
- A Hermes agent for daily research (where memory pays off)
- A Harness agent for anything code-related (where speed counts)
- A Hermes channel for human alerts (where the team already is)
- An orchestrator in front so the decision is a rule, not a choice
You don't need to code this orchestrator. Tools like Make, N8N, or a simple script do the job. The important thing is not leaving any agent alone facing the result.
